Which equations and/or functions represent the graphed line? Select three options.
9966 [12]

Answer:

Point slope form : y-3=\frac{1}{2}(x-2)

Slope intercept form: y=\frac{1}{2}(x)+2

Standard form : -x+2y=4

Step-by-step explanation:

From the given graph it is clear that the line is passing through the points, (-4, 0), (-2, 1), (0, 2), and (2, 3).

If a line passes through two points (x_1,y_1) and (x_2,y_2), then the equation of line is

y-y_1=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}(x-x_1)

Let as consider any two points of the line:  (2, 3) and (0, 2).

The equation of line is

y-3=\frac{2-3}{0-2}(x-2)

y-3=\frac{1}{2}(x-2)

The point slope form of the line is y-3=\frac{1}{2}(x-2).

y-3=\frac{1}{2}(x)-\frac{1}{2}(2)

y-3=\frac{1}{2}(x)-1

Add 3 on both sides.

y=\frac{1}{2}(x)-1+3

y=\frac{1}{2}(x)+2

Therefore the slope intercept form of the line is y=\frac{1}{2}(x)+2.

Multiply both sides by 2.

2y=x+4

-x+2y=4

Therefore, the standard form of the line is -x+2y=4.

Find the area of a sector with a central angle of 170° and a diameter of 9.1 cm. Round to the nearest tenth.
Nesterboy [21]
A central angle:
α = 170°
d = 9.1 cm
r = 9.1 : 2 = 4.55 cm
Area of a sector:
A = r² π α / 360°
A = ( 4.55 )² · 3.14 · 170° / 360°
A = 30.7 cm²

Sketch the solid described by x 2 + y 2 ≤ z ≤ 1. Use the Divergence Theorem to evaluate the surface integral over the boundary o
kirill115 [55]

Looks like

\vec F(x,y,z)=y\,\vec\imath+z\,\vec\jmath+xz\,\vec k

The solid described by x^2+y^2\le z\le 1 is the interior of the region bounded by the paraboloid z=x^2+y^2 and the plane z=1. Call this region R.

By the divergence theorem,

\displaystyle\iint_{\partial R}\vec F\cdot\mathrm d\vec S=\iiint_R\mathrm{div}\vec F\,\mathrm dV

The divergence is

\mathrm{div}\vec F(x,y,z)=(y)_x+(z)_y+(xz)_z=x

so that the surface integral reduces to

\displaystyle\iiint_Rx\,\mathrm dV

or in cylindrical coordinates,

\displaystyle\int_0^{2\pi}\int_0^1\int_{r^2}^1r^2\cos\theta\,\mathrm dz\,\mathrm dr\,\mathrm d\theta=\boxed{0}
